The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. Hampton High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Allison Park, PA, in the Hampton neighborhood, and is served by the Hampton Township School District in Pennsylvania. Annual tuition is $0. The school has a total enrollment of 895 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 15:1. Academic records show that 92%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 83% are proficient in reading. Hampton High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of A and a GreatSchools Rating of 9 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.65, the graduation rate is 97%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1270 and an ACT score of 30.
